Kompiuterinių žaidimų dirbtinio intelekto varikliuko uždaviniai ir jų sprendimas / The Problems and Solutions of Artificial Intelligence Engine for GamesFiodorova, Jelena 30 May 2006 (has links)
Game Artificial Intelligence (AI) is the code in game that makes the computer-controlled opponents (agents) to make smart decisions in game world. There are some AI problems that are essential in games: pathfinding, decision making, generating player’s characteristics, game’s logic management. However these problems are gameplay dependant. The main goal of this study – to generalize AI problems’ solutions for games of many kinds, that is, to make AI solutions gameplay independent. We have achieved this goal by using data-driven design in our solutions. We separated the game logic and the game code levels by using this approach. Such separation gave us an opportunity to manipulate game logic and data freely. We have examined our decision making system and determined that it is flexible and is easy of use.
Interaktyvių e – mokymo sistemų pritaikymas paslaugoms orientuotai Grid architektūrai / Interactive e-learning system adaptation for service oriented Grid architectureJukniūtė, Aistė 16 August 2007 (has links)
Daugėjant informacijos ir paslaugų kiekiui internete tradicinės elektroninio mokymo architektūros vis sunkiau patenkina iškylančius integracijos, išplėtimo, resursų valdymo poreikius. Nauja paslaugom orientuota architektūra, įgyvendinama žiniatinklio paslaugų technologijomis bei Grid aplinka yra tinkamas būdas efektyviam ir kokybiškam e-mokymui užtikrinti. Šiame darbe nagrinėjama kokias naujas galimybes e-mokymo srityje atveria paslaugom orientuota Grid architektūra. Tam kad būtų galima pasinaudoti naujomis galimybėmis turimą sistemą reikia modifikuoti. Pateikiamos rekomendacijos egzistuojančios interaktyvios e-mokymo taikomosios programos adaptacijai Grid paslaugų architektūrai. Šios rekomendacijos realizuoja esamą sistemą kaip paslaugą ar paslaugų rinkinį. Sudarytos rekomendacijos praktiškai išbandomos pritaikant realią nuotolinę testavimo sistemą Grid paslaugų aplinkai. Eksperimentinėje dalyje yra įvertinta nauda, kurią suteikia sistemos realizavimas Grid paslaugomis išplečiamumo, lankstumo bei pakartotinio panaudojimo požiūriu. / The increasing amount of information and services on the internet continues to grow, traditional e-learning architectures are unable to satisfy the need of integration, flexibility and resource management. The new service oriented architecture based on web services technologies and Grid environment is the effective and valuable way to develop e-learning. In this master thesis new e-learning opportunities based on service oriented Grid architecture are analyzed. In order to use new approaches the existing system has to be modified. Recommendations for the existing interactive e-learning applications adaptation for the service oriented Grid environment are presented. These recommendations implement the current systems as a service or set of services. The proposed recommendations are tested practically adapting the real distant assessment system for Grid service environment. The added value of this new approach is evaluated taking into consideration scalability, flexibility and reusability of Grid services in the experimentation part.
ALU SystemC modelių tyrimas ir kūrimas / ALU SystemC model analysis and developmentKuprys, Simonas 16 August 2007 (has links)
Magistro darbe analizuojami aritmetinio loginio įtaiso (ALU) modeliai, operacijos ir architektūros. Išanalizavus mokslinę literatūrą, pasirenkama ALU architektūra bei atliekamų operacijų aibė. Realizuojamas dviejų pakopų sudalintos operacijų aibės ALU modelis. Atlikus apibendrinimą atliekami eksperimentai. Eksperimento modeliai modifikuojami – atliekamas ALU operacijų sudalinimas tarp ALU ir valdančios logikos (CU) operacijų poaibių. Nagrinėjami konkrečių ALU operacijų atlikimo pirmos arba antros pakopos modulyje pranašumai ir trūkumai. Sukurti parametrizuoti (bendriniai) ALU modeliai su kintamo duomenų pločio operandais. ALU modeliai aprašyti aparatūros aprašymo kalba SystemC, sumodeliuoti ir susintezuoti. Gauti ALU SystemC modelių sintezės rezultatai parodė operacijų aibės sudalinimo bei skirtumo tarp retai ir dažnai naudojamų operacijų perkėlimo į skirtingas pakopas poveikį pagrindinėms lusto charakteristikoms: plotui, signalo vėlinimui ir energijos suvartojimui. Optimalus operacijų aibės sudalinimas dviejų pakopų architektūroje leidžia pasiekti reikiamos projektuojamo įtaiso charakteristikos pagerėjimą. Taikant šį metodą, galima kritinei (daug aparatūros resursų naudojančiai) ALU operacijai sudaryti mažesnį plotą luste užimantį arba mažiau energijos suvartojantį ALU variantą. / This work studies arithmetic logic unit (ALU) models, operations and architectures. ALU architecture and operation set is chosen based on the analysis of the known scientific publications. Two-stage divided operation set ALU model is implemented and used for the experiments. The experimental ALU models are modified using different variants of partitioning of ALU operation set, when ALU operations are divided between main ALU block and control unit (CU). Pros and cons of ALU operation performance in the first or the second stage are examined. Developed generic ALU models can be instatiated for data operands with variable data width. ALU models are coded in a high-level hardware description language SystemC, simulated and synthesized. The results of ALU SystemC model synthesis showed the effect of the division of the operation set on the main chip characteristics: area, delay and energy consumption and the difference of subdivision of rare or often used operations into different ALU stages. Optimal subdivision of operation set in two-stage ALU architecture allows getting a better performance of the designed device. Using this method the designer can select an instance of ALU that has a smaller area and consumes less energy for critical (using more hardware resources) operation.
Mobilios programos transformavimas iš vienos platformos į kitą / Transforming Mobile app Source Code from One Platform to the Other OneBagatavičius, Evaldas 26 August 2013 (has links)
Mobilių technologijų populiarėjimas tarp vartotojų ir jų platformų įvairovė skatina mobilių programėlių kūrėjus užimti vis didesnę rinkos dalį. Kiekviena mobili platforma turi savo specifiką, todėl kūrėjams reikia vis daugiau žinių arba specialistų kuriant mobilias aplikacijas, tam reikalinga papildomų resursų, apmokymų,kaštų ir laiko. Vienas iš galimų problemos sprendimų, sukurti tam tikrus įrankius, kurie mobilių programėlių projektavimo ir kūrimo bei testavimo etape, leistų automatiškai suprojektuoti, suprogramuoti mobilias aplikacijas, nepriklausomai kokiai platformai išlaikant tos programėlės logiką. Tam pakaktų mobilių programų kūrėjams turėti vienai mobiliai platformai aprašytą modelį arba programėlę, ir iš jų remiantis MDA (Model Dirven Architecture) metodologijomis arba aprašytais karkasais atliktų transformacijas į reikiamą platformą. Šiame darbe pateikimas MDA principais paremtos sukurtos priemonės , kurios, atlieka programų transformacijas iš Android į Windows Phone. Įrodant transformacijų svarbą, atliktas transformavimo priemonių tyrimas, įvedant tam tikras metrikas ir jų palyginimą tarp atskirai realizuotų programų, šių priemonių transformuotų programų ir naudojant universalias priemones kaip JavaScript arba žiniatinklio principu veikiančių programų. / There is growth of mobile technologies and platforms providing for users so and developers of mobile applications need to take a larger market. There is some specificity of platforms, therefore developer needs a more knowledge or experts of mobile application developing where require a more resources, training, costs and it takes a time. One of the possible solutions to the problem, to make the tools which allow design and create mobile applications independent by platform keep the logic in design and development or testing phase. This is sufficient for developers to design or creates one mobile applications and using methods of Mobile Driven Architecture (MDA) and frameworks create transformations more applications many platforms. In this research paper representing the tools developed based MDA to carry out transformations from Android to Windows Phone. To prove the importance of transformations performed research of transformation tools with certain comparison of metrics between the programs of separated implementation, these tools transformed programs and used universal tools like JavaScript or web-based software implementation.
Miestų architektūros formavimo politika ir visuomenė šiuolaikinės demokratijos sąlygomis / The Policy of Development of Urban Architecture and Society Under Modern Democratic CinditionsJakaitis, Jonas 27 March 2007 (has links)
On the threshold of the 21st century (in the 1990s), public organizations of European and other countries focused their attention on the problems, the solution of which could help improve standards of living in the cities and towns. Theoretical propositions about the citizens’ right to protection from aggression, environmental pollution and aggressive urban environment as well as the rights to shelter, health care, cultural life, mobility, democratic control of authorities and participation in the development of democratic principles have been analyzed in the great number of documents and in this investigation from various perspectives. The aim is to describe the process of society participation in the development of urban architecture showing the main trends, principles and methods, and to optimize, rationalize the process of developing urban architecture on the principles of sustainable development.
Metaprojektavimo aspektų realizavimas pakartotinio naudojimo technologija grindžiamose informacinėse sistemose / Implementation of meta-design aspects for information systems based on reuse technologyRidikaitė, Milda 16 August 2007 (has links)
Dokumento tikslas yra pristatyti pakartotinio panaudojimo technologijos, komponentais grįsto projektavimo ir metaprojektavimo aspektų simbiozės. Simbiozė realizuojama per programinės įrangos architektūros modelį ir rinkinį pakartotinio panaudojimo komponentų, kurie sukurti įtraukti galutinį vartotoją į programinės įrangos procesą kaip projektuotoją. / The aim of this paper is to present symbiosis of reuse technology, component based design and meta-project aspects. Symbiosis occurs through software architectural model and set of reusable components designed to involve end-user to software development process as designer. Theoretical background of specified model is delivered in the beginning sections of this thesis. As experimental solution information system was introduced. System provides a pack of highly configurable and customizable components designed to achieve common tasks. Unexpected or rare tasks are solved by providing extra components, which are developed and integrated to entire system according predefined rules. Several complete definitions and application areas of those components are given. Paper also includes statistics about reusable component life cycle in different software projects: how often they are reused and for what purpose. Thesis is concluded with pros and cons of suggested model.
XX a.pabaigoje -XXI a. pradžioje Lietuvos sakralinių pastatų architektūrinių ir konstrukcinių sprendinių analizė / Analysis of architectural and structural solutions in sacral buildings of Lithuanian at the end of the 20th - 21th centuryStasiūnaitė, Neringa 30 September 2008 (has links)
Darbe nagirnėjami XX a. pabaigos – XXI a. pradžios Lietuvoje pastatytų sakralinių pastatų - katalikų bažnyčių architektūriniai ir konstrukciniai sprendiniai. Aptariama bažnyčių erdvinės - tūrinės kompozicijos, planinės struktūros, urbanistinis kontekstas ir konstrukcinės sistemos. / In thesis of the master analyzing of architectural and structural solutions in sacral buildings of Lithuanian at the end of the 20th - the beginning of the 21th century. The church's are important in architectural and cultural history, they are important of the nation culturally. Sacral buildings represented material and mental valuables of their century, so they are interesting subject of architecture.
Kauno pramoninės architektūros paveldas: kūrybinių industrijų ir turizmo plėtros galimybės / Kaunas heritage of industrial architecture: creative industries and tourism development opportunitiesKliukaitė, Sandra 04 September 2009 (has links)
Apibrėžiamos pramoninės architektūros paveldo regeneracijos ir pritaikymo idėjos, būdai ir formos. Analizuojami post-industrinio Kauno pramoninės architektūros paveldo objektai; jų architektūrinė ir paveldosauginė specifika, išsidėstymas urbanistinėje miesto struktūroje. Svarstomos kūrybinių industrijų ir turizmo plėtros galimybės pramoninės architektūros paveldo kompleksuose bei istorinėse pramoninėse teritorijose. Pramoninės funkcijos išsaugojimo ir realizuotų konversijų atvejų studijos rodo dabartinę Kauno pramoninės architektūros objektų paveldosauginę situaciją, regeneracijos privalumus ir trūkumus. Revitalizacijos ir kūrybinės veiklos formų analizė atskleidžia pramoninės architektūros paveldo pritaikymo galimybių įvairovę ir nurodo pagrindines panaudos tendencijas. Darbe sumodeliuotos, Nemuno slėnyje esančių pramoninės architektūros paveldo objektų, pritaikymo vizijos yra teorinio pobūdžio. Sukurtas koncepcinis Kauno pramonės paveldo turistinis maršrutas gali būti taikomas praktiškai. Pramoninės architektūros paveldo pristatymui internetinėje medijoje sėkmingai pritaikytas pasaulinis interneto socialinis tinklas, ateityje gali būti įvairiai plėtojamas. / The research provides the ideas, methods and forms of regeneration and adaptation of the industrial architectural heritage. The analysis of the industrial architectural heritage objects in post-industrial city Kaunas, gives an information about heritage preservation, architectural specifics and location of objects in urban city structure. The research also provides the opportunities of creative industries and tourism for the development in industrial complexes and the historic industrial sites. The study of saved industrial function and implemented conversions shows: current situation of Kaunas industrial architectural heritage objects, the advantages and disadvantages of regeneration. The analysis of revitalization and creative activities - reveals the diversity of adaptation opportunities in industrial architectural heritage, and indicates the trends of using. There was also designed some theoretical visions of adaptation of industrial architectural heritage objects in the Valley of Nemunas. Developed conceptual Kaunas heritage tour route may be applied in practice. The presentation of industrial heritage realized in internet media. It successfully adapted in global internet social network. In the future this online project can be developed in different ways.
Molbertinės tapybos kūriniai Lietuvos visuomeninių pastatų architektūroje / Easel Painting in the Architecture of Lithuanian Public BuildingsVitkauskas, Sigitas 30 June 2011 (has links)
Magistro baigiamajame darbe „Molbertinės tapybos darbai Lietuvos visuomeninių pastatų architektūroje“ nagrinėjami XX-XXI a. pr. Lietuvos visuomenių pastatų interjerai, kurių svarbi meninės raiškos priemonė yra molbertinės tapybos paveikslai. Išsamiai analizuojamos paveikslų naudojimo visuomeniniuose interjeruose prasmės, tapybos integravimo architektūroje istorinės raidos ir dabarties tendencijos. Išryškinami tapybos ir interjero architektūros sąveikos kompoziciniai principai ir dermės dėsningumai. Daroma išvada, kad tiek estetiniu, tiek semantiniu požiūriu tapybos kūriniai gali būti svarbūs architektūrinės erdvės formantai ir, nepaisant daiktinės aplinkos formavimo tendencijų XX a. pabaigoje - XXI a. pr. pokyčių, molbertinės tapybos naudojimas architektūroje išlieka tvarus. Darbo apimtis - 94 psl. 97 iliustracios, 1 lentelė, 94 bibliografiniai šaltiniai. / In master's thesis final paper work “Easel painting in the architecture of Lithuanian public buildings” interiors of public buildings at the period of XX and the beginning of XXI century in Lithuania are considered. Easel paintings have a very important mean of art expression in these interiors. Meanings of use of paintings in interiors of public buildings, historical developments and tendencies of paintings integration in nowadays architecture are analyzed at length. Fundamentals and consistent pattern of harmony of interaction between painting and architecture of interior are highlighted. The conclusion is done that painting works could be important formants of architectural space in esthetical and semantic points of view. Moreover, the usage of easel painting remains stable despite the tendency changes in formation of materialistic surrounding at the end of XX century and at the beginning of XXI century. Size of the paper work - 94 pages, 97 figures, 1 table, 94 bibliographical sources.
Medinės ponų namų architektūros raida Lietuvoje XVI a. vid.– XIX a. vid / Evolution of wooden architecture of manor houses in Lithuania (from the middle of the 16th century till the middle of the 19th century)Puodžiukienė, Dalė 27 July 2011 (has links)
Disertacijoje nagrinėjami Lietuvos bajorijos mediniai gyvenamieji pastatai, darbe vadinami ponų namais. Darbo t i k s l a s – išaiškinti ir pateikti Lietuvos bajorų namų medinės architektūros raidą nuo Valakų reformos iki 1861 Valstiečių reformos. Darbe tirti esami bei neišlikę (žinomi dėka šaltinių) mediniai bajorijos namai, nustatyti vyravę pastatų tipai, priežastys, lėmusios tipų kaitą, atskleidžiami architektūros ypatumai, ponų namo santykis su etnine ir profesionaliąja architektūra. Tyrimai parodė, kad skirtingų bajorijos sluoksnių ponų namų architektūros raida vyko skirtingai. Stambių ir vidutinių bajorų namų raida buvo intensyvi, ją ypač veikė stilinės architektūros pokyčiai. Smulkių bajorų namai kito mažai, statyboje laikytasi etninių tradicijų. Pagal stambių ir vidutinių bajorų XVI a. vidurio– XIX a. vidurio pastatų planines ir tūrines –erdvines struktūras ir formas, išskirti trys architektūrinės raidos etapai: ankstyvasis- formavimosi (iki XVII a. vidurio), „barokinis“ (XVII a. vidurio – XVIII a. septinto dešimtmečio); „klasicistinis“ (XVIII a. pabaigos – XIX a. vidurio). Pirmajame etape iš esmės pakito gyvenamosios erdvės sankloda ir namo įvaizdis: vietoje kelių skirtingų funkcijų namų, skirtų bajoro šeimai ir jo svečiams (gyvenamojo, pokylių namo, ir kt.) susiformavo vienas daugiafunkcinis, parterinis, simetriškos kompozicijos ponų namas. Antrajame ir trečiajame etapuose daugiafunkcinis ponų namas buvo tobulinamas pagal etiketo (gyvenimo būdo) ir vyravusių... [toliau žr. visą tekstą] / Doctoral thesis Evolution of wooden architecture of manor houses in Lithuania (from the middle of 16th century till the middle of 19th century) explore and present an evolution of the wooden architecture of manor houses since the middle of the 16th century till the middle of the 19th century. The thesis investigates the existing and not existing (known from the sources) wooden residential buildings of Lithuanian nobility, identifies their dominant types and reasons, which influenced the change of architecture, and reveals the singularities of the architecture and the relation of a manor’s house with ethnic and professional architecture. The research has shown that the architectural evolution of the manor house owned by nobility of different rank was developing differently. The development of great and middle-class nobility’s manor house was intense, especially influenced by the changes in style architecture. The small noblemen‘s houses were changing a little, their construction followed the ethnic traditions. According to the layout and shape of structures and forms of the buildings set on the manors of great and middle-class nobility, three stages of their architectural evolution were singled out: the period of early formation (till the middle of the 17th century), “baroque” period (from the middle of the 17th century till the seventh decade of the 18th century) and the “classicism” period (from the end of 18th century till the end of the 19th century). The doctoral thesis... [to full text]
